You will learn that Search Console now tracks posts on Instagram, TikTok, X, and YouTube. Performance, Insights, and Achievements reports reveal queries, clicks, impressions, and milestone activity. Marketers can finally attribute discovery and optimize social content for Search and Discover.
Google updated merchant listing markup, adding a category property and sale price guidance. This affects product classification at page level, and plugin compatibility matters for implementation. John Mueller advises against creating separate markdown pages for AI, warning about maintenance and divergence. Fix your HTML, focus on accessibility, and avoid parallel machine-only copies.
